What to Expect from Detox Centers in St. Simons

Safe, Structured, and Medically Supported Detox Care

Detox programs in St. Simons are designed to prioritize safety, comfort, and long‑term recovery readiness.You can expect:

Comprehensive medical and psychological intake assessments

24/7 monitoring by licensed medical professionals

Medication‑assisted treatment when clinically appropriate

Individualized detox plans based on substance use history

Supportive, private environments that promote stabilization

Discharge planning with referrals to continued treatment
